Welcome to the discussion of US Politics!

Rules:

  1. Post only links to articles. Title must fairly describe link contents. If your title differs from the site’s, it should only be to add context or be more descriptive. Do not post entire articles in the body or in the comments.

Links must be to the original source, not an aggregator like Google Amp, MSN, or Yahoo.

Example:

  1. Articles must be relevant to US politics and contain quality and original content. Social Media adjacent hosts like Substack are allowed, but ONLY if they tie back to a company/subsidiary. No personal or friend group blogs and no self-promotion. Articles should be worth reading. Clickbait, stub articles, and re-hosted or stolen content are not allowed. Check your source for Reliability and Bias here.
  2. Be civil, No violations of TOS. It’s OK to say the subject of an article is behaving like a (pejorative, pejorative). It’s NOT OK to say another USER is (pejorative). Strong language is fine, just not directed at other members. Engage in good-faith and with respect! This includes accusing other users of being bots or paid actors.
  3. No memes, trolling, misinformation, or low-effort posts/comments (including reposts). If you see posts like this that anger you, do not engage. Report, block, and live a happier life than they do. Any slap-fight is subject to comment removals. Fights full of rule violations will result in temporary bans to cool off.
  4. No manipulating votes via bots or alt accounts; this will result in permanent bans. Vote based on comment quality, not agreement. This community aims to foster discussion; please reward people for putting effort into articulating their viewpoint, even if you disagree with it.
  5. No hate speech, slurs, celebrating death, advocating violence, or abusive language. This will result in an account ban. Usernames containing racist, or inappropriate slurs will be permanently banned.

We ask that the users report any comment or post that violate the rules and use critical thinking when reading, posting, and commenting. Users that repeatedly have comments or posts removed, weaponize reports, or violate the code of conduct, will be banned.

All posts and comments will be reviewed on a case-by-case basis. This means that some content that violates the rules may be allowed, while other content that does not violate the rules may be removed. The moderators retain the right to remove any content and ban users. The reason(s) behind moderator action(s) are publicly available through the Modlog.

That’s all the rules!
